Simplify negative 3 and 3 over 4 minus 7 and 1 over 3.

11 and 1 over 12
negative 10 and 2 over 7
negative 43 over 12
negative 133 over 12

Final answer:

To simplify negative 3 and 3 over 4 minus 7 and 1 over 3, convert mixed numbers to improper fractions and find a common denominator to subtract. The simplified expression is negative 133 over 12.

Step-by-step explanation:

To simplify the expression negative 3 and 3 over 4 minus 7 and 1 over 3,

first convert the mixed numbers to improper fractions.

Negative 3 and 3 over 4 is -3 - \(\frac{3}{4}\), which can be written as an improper fraction -\(\frac{15}{4}\) (since -3 \(\times\) 4 = -12, and -12 + 3 = -15).

Similarly, 7 and 1 over 3 is 7 + \(\frac{1}{3}\), which can be written as an improper fraction \(\frac{22}{3}\) (since 7 \(\times\) 3 = 21, and 21 + 1 = 22).

Now subtract the second fraction from the first: -\(\frac{15}{4}\) - \(\frac{22}{3}\). To do this, find a common denominator, which is 12 in this case, and rewrite the fractions: -\(\frac{45}{12}\) - \(\frac{88}{12}\).

Combining the numerators, we get -\(\frac{133}{12}\), which is the simplified form of the expression.

Therefore, the correct answer is negative 133 over 12.
